Abstract
A malonohydrazide derivative bearing an imine and phenolic group was synthesized and had a high affinity and selectivity towards Zn2+. The recognition properties of receptor 1 were evaluated using absorbance and fluorescence spectroscopy. The 1:1 stoichiometry of 1.Zn2+ was confirmed from job׳s plot, mass spectra and density functional theory (DFT). The detection of Zn2+ in intracellular environment of HeLa cell through confocal microscopy was successfully applied for live cell imaging.
